## Problem
`TsFileWriter::do_check_schema` shows noticeable CPU overhead when writing
repeated tablets with the same device and schema.
In our workload, each writer repeatedly writes tablets for a fixed device
with a fixed set of measurements. However,
`write_tablet()` calls `do_check_schema()` for every tablet write. This
appears to repeatedly perform schema lookup and
measurement-name matching even though the schema has already been
registered and does not change during the file lifecycle.
## Evidence
Using Windows Performance Analyzer on a 60-second TsFile archive workload,
the active processing window showed:
-
`TsFileArchive.dll!storage::TsFileWriter::do_check_schema<MeasurementNamesFromTablet>`
as the top TsFileArchive function
hotspot
- `std::string::compare` also appeared as a related hotspot
- The workload writes tablets with the same device and the same schema
repeatedly
- TsFile writing took longer than the input data duration
Example hotspot:
```text
TsFileArchive.dll!storage::TsFileWriter::do_check_schema<storage::MeasurementNamesFromTablet>
```
## Suspected Cause
write_tablet() creates or looks up schema information on every call:
- creates a StringArrayDeviceID from tablet.insert_target_name_
- looks up the device in schemas_
- iterates all measurement names
- looks up each measurement in measurement_schema_map_
- fills chunk_writers and data_types
For wide tablets and high-frequency writes, this repeated per-tablet
schema validation becomes expensive.
## Suggested Optimization
Add a cached or prepared schema path for repeated tablet writes.
Possible approaches:
1. Cache the resolved schema for the last used device/tablet schema inside
TsFileWriter.
2. Add an explicit prepared API, for example:
PreparedTabletSchema prepare_tablet_schema(device_id, schema_vec);
int write_tablet_prepared(const Tablet& tablet, const
PreparedTabletSchema& prepared);
The cached/prepared data could include:
- MeasurementSchemaGroup*
- resolved ChunkWriter* list
- resolved TSDataType list
This would allow repeated writes with the same device and schema to skip
per-column name lookup.
## Expected Benefit
Reduce CPU overhead in high-throughput TsFile writing workloads,
especially for wide schemas where the same tablet schema is
written repeatedly.
## Notes
This should preserve the existing validation behavior for dynamic schemas
or changing devices. The optimization can be limited
to cache hits where both device and schema identity match.
